diff --git a/include/builtins.h b/include/builtins.h index e98abed..a01a597 100644 --- a/include/builtins.h +++ b/include/builtins.h @@ -6,7 +6,7 @@ /* By: adjoly +#+ +:+ +#+ */ /* +#+#+#+#+#+ +#+ */ /* Created: 2024/06/22 13:05:18 by adjoly #+# #+# */ -/* Updated: 2024/06/25 17:01:43 by adjoly ### ########.fr */ +/* Updated: 2024/06/26 08:37:31 by mmoussou ### ########.fr */ /* */ /* ************************************************************************** */ @@ -21,4 +21,7 @@ void ft_pwd(void); void ft_cd(t_env *env, char *args); char *ret_cwd(void); +void ft_env(t_env *env); +void ft_unset(char *arg, t_env *env); + #endif diff --git a/src/builtins/ft_env.c b/src/builtins/ft_env.c new file mode 100644 index 0000000..45b6f4d --- /dev/null +++ b/src/builtins/ft_env.c @@ -0,0 +1,22 @@ +/* ************************************************************************** */ +/* */ +/* ::: :::::::: */ +/* ft_env.c :+: :+: :+: */ +/* +:+ +:+ +:+ */ +/* By: mmoussou name, env->content); + env = env->next; + } +} diff --git a/src/builtins/ft_export.c b/src/builtins/ft_export.c new file mode 100644 index 0000000..36fb273 --- /dev/null +++ b/src/builtins/ft_export.c @@ -0,0 +1,54 @@ +/* ************************************************************************** */ +/* */ +/* ::: :::::::: */ +/* ft_export.c :+: :+: :+: */ +/* +:+ +:+ +:+ */ +/* By: mmoussou